Senior Backend Engineer (Elixir)

Senior Backend Engineer (Elixir)

Vollzeit 50000 - 70000 € / Jahr (geschätzt) Home Office möglich
Go Premium
G

Auf einen Blick

  • Aufgaben: Entwickle innovative Backend-Lösungen mit Elixir und arbeite an spannenden Projekten.
  • Arbeitgeber: Remote ist ein globales Unternehmen mit einer unterstützenden und innovativen Kultur.
  • Mitarbeitervorteile: Flexibles Arbeiten, wettbewerbsfähiges Gehalt, Aktienoptionen und umfassende Vorteile.
  • Andere Informationen: Vollständig remote, mit einem starken Fokus auf persönliche und berufliche Entwicklung.
  • Warum dieser Job: Gestalte die Zukunft der Arbeit und habe einen echten Einfluss auf globale Teams.
  • Gewünschte Qualifikationen: Erfahrung in der Softwareentwicklung, insbesondere mit Elixir und CI/CD-Tools.

Das voraussichtliche Gehalt liegt zwischen 50000 - 70000 € pro Jahr.

Remote löst die größte Herausforderung moderner Organisationen – die Einhaltung globaler Beschäftigungsrichtlinien mit Leichtigkeit. Wir ermöglichen es Unternehmen jeder Größe, internationale Teams zu rekrutieren, zu bezahlen und zu verwalten. Mit unseren Kernwerten im Herzen und einer zukunftsorientierten Arbeitskultur arbeitet unser Team unermüdlich an ehrgeizigen Problemen, asynchron, rund um die Welt. Alle unsere Positionen sind vollständig remote.

Die Position

Sie werden Teil eines Teams von Ingenieuren in den Bereichen Frontend, Backend, SRE und QA. Wir sind in funktionsübergreifende Entwicklungsteams organisiert, die bestimmten Vertikalen zugewiesen sind. Diese Rolle ist für mehrere Teams offen, und wir werden das genaue Team, dem Sie während des Interviewprozesses beitreten werden, basierend auf den geschäftlichen Bedürfnissen und Ihren Präferenzen definieren. Unabhängig vom spezifischen Team werden Sie an der Entwicklung von Tools, APIs und Integrationen für eines unserer Produkte arbeiten. Unser Backend ist mit Elixir und Phoenix aufgebaut, mit einer Postgres-Datenbank. Wir verwenden React und Nextjs für unser Frontend. Gitlab wird als Versionskontrollwerkzeug, Issue-Tracker und CI/CD-Lösung verwendet. Unsere Anwendungen werden auf AWS gehostet. Wir verlassen uns vollständig auf unser CI für Deployments und führen mehrmals täglich Deployments durch.

Was Ihnen dieser Job bieten kann

  • Komplexe und bedeutungsvolle Herausforderungen — deren Lösung ermöglicht es Menschen und Unternehmen, in jedem Land der Welt zu leben und zu arbeiten.
  • Die Möglichkeit, einen signifikanten Einfluss auf das Geschäft zu haben — wir sind noch sehr früh in unserer Reise als Unternehmen, und jede Änderung, die Sie heute vornehmen, wird durch das Wachstum des Unternehmens verstärkt.
  • Viel Freiheit, Ihre Arbeit und Ihr Leben zu organisieren — Sie sind nicht an tägliche Standups, wiederkehrende Meetings oder andere Zeremonien gebunden.
  • Wettbewerbsfähiges Gehalt, Aktienoptionen, flexible bezahlte Freizeit und eine Reihe von Vergünstigungen und Leistungen.
  • Ein unterstützendes und freundliches Arbeitsumfeld, in dem wir möchten, dass Sie Dogmen herausfordern und Innovationen verfolgen!
  • Ein starkes Team erfahrener Ingenieure, die Ihre berufliche Entwicklung unterstützen und fördern.

Was Sie mitbringen

  • Starke Ingenieurgrundlagen und eine Erfolgsbilanz beim Versand von Produktionssystemen, die sicher, zuverlässig und skalierbar sind.
  • Praktische Erfahrung in der Gestaltung oder Annahme von agentischen/Automatisierungs-Workflows (oder vergleichbaren Systemen) und deren Verbesserung durch Iteration.
  • Fähigkeit, systemisch zu denken: Spezifikationen klar zu definieren, Pläne zu zerlegen, Verifizierung zu instrumentieren und den Kreislauf der Qualität zu schließen.
  • Postgres (oder ähnlich).
  • CI/CD (GitLab, Github, Jenkins oder ähnlich).

Schlüsselverantwortlichkeiten

  • Leitung der Entwicklung wichtiger teambezogener Projekte, Teilnahme an teamübergreifenden Initiativen für Remote's HR- und Payroll-Produkte.
  • Aktive Teilnahme an Produktarbeiten im Team: Feedback geben, Lösungen für Probleme vorschlagen.
  • Technische Einblicke und Fachwissen nutzen, um Produktverbesserungen vorzuschlagen.
  • Gutes Verständnis des Bereichs des Teams, sowohl aus Produkt- als auch aus Ingenieursicht.
  • Feedback zu Code-Reviews geben.
  • Zur gemeinsamen Codebasis beitragen.
  • Technische und geschäftliche Probleme debuggen und lösen.
  • An nicht-teambezogenen Aktivitäten teilnehmen, wie z.B. Support-Rotationen, Einstellungsprozess, RFC-Diskussionen usw.
  • Andere Ingenieure mentorieren und anleiten.
  • Untersuchung, Vorschlag und Teilnahme an der Implementierung von Verbesserungen unserer Plattform.
  • Schnittstellen mit Leistung, Zugänglichkeit und API-Design im Hinterkopf implementieren.
  • Neu gestalten, wie Ingenieurarbeit mit autonomen Agenten als standardmäßiger Ausführungsschicht versendet wird.
  • Agentische Workflows end-to-end (Spezifikation → Plan → Ausführung → Verifizierung) vorschlagen und operationalisieren, um Ergebnisse schneller zu liefern.
  • Wiederverwendbare agentische Workflows und Primitiven in der Codebasis erstellen, damit Teams diese wiederholt über verschiedene Bereiche hinweg anwenden können.
  • Verifizierungsschleifen (Tests, Prüfungen, Bewertungen, Sicherheitsvorkehrungen) nutzen, um sicherzustellen, dass die Ergebnisse korrekt, sicher, zuverlässig und skalierbar sind.

Praktisches

  • Berichtsweg: Engineering Team Leader
  • Team: Engineering
  • Standort: Überall auf der Welt
  • Startdatum: So schnell wie möglich

Bewerbungsprozess

  • Interview mit unserem Recruiter
  • Interview mit einem Engineering-Leiter (asynchron)
  • Codeübung und -überprüfung
  • Interview mit Mitgliedern des Engineering-Teams
  • Bar Raiser Interview
  • Executive Interview mit VP of Engineering
  • Angebot und Überprüfung der vorherigen Beschäftigung

Remote's Total Rewards-Philosophie stellt sicher, dass faire, unvoreingenommene Vergütung und faire Eigenkapitalvergütung sowie wettbewerbsfähige Vorteile in allen Ländern, in denen wir tätig sind, gewährleistet sind. Wir stimmen billigen Arbeitspraktiken nicht zu und ermutigen diese daher nicht, und stellen sicher, dass wir über den lokalen Tarifen zahlen. Wir hoffen, andere Unternehmen zu inspirieren, globale Talente einzustellen und lokalen Wohlstand in Entwicklungsländer zu bringen.

Die jährliche Gehaltsspanne für diese Vollzeitstelle liegt zwischen 53.300 und 119.850 USD.

Leistungen

  • Arbeiten von überall
  • Flexible bezahlte Freizeit
  • Flexible Arbeitszeiten (wir arbeiten asynchron)
  • 16 Wochen bezahlter Elternurlaub
  • Unterstützungsdienste für psychische Gesundheit
  • Aktienoptionen
  • Budget für Weiterbildung
  • Budget für das Homeoffice und IT-Ausrüstung
  • Budget für lokale persönliche Veranstaltungen oder Co-Working-Spaces

Wie Sie Ihren Tag (und Ihr Leben) planen

Wir arbeiten asynchron bei Remote, was bedeutet, dass Sie Ihren Zeitplan um Ihr Leben herum planen können (und nicht um Meetings). Sie werden ermächtigt, Verantwortung zu übernehmen und proaktiv zu sein. Wenn Sie Zweifel haben, werden Sie standardmäßig aktiv, anstatt zu warten. Ihre Work-Life-Balance ist wichtig, und Sie werden ermutigt, sich selbst und Ihre Familie an erste Stelle zu setzen und die Arbeit um Ihre Bedürfnisse herum zu gestalten. Wenn sich das nach etwas anhört, das Sie wollen, bewerben Sie sich jetzt!

Wie man sich bewirbt

Bitte füllen Sie das untenstehende Formular aus und laden Sie Ihren Lebenslauf im PDF-Format hoch. Wir bitten Sie, Ihre Bewerbung und Ihren Lebenslauf auf Englisch einzureichen, da dies die standardisierte Sprache ist, die wir hier bei Remote verwenden.

Wir ermutigen nicht nur Personen aus allen ethnischen Gruppen, Geschlechtern, sexuellen Orientierungen, Altersgruppen, Fähigkeiten, Behinderungsstatus und anderen unterrepräsentierten Gruppen zur Bewerbung, sondern priorisieren auch ein Gefühl der Zugehörigkeit. Wir haben 4 ERGs (Frauen, Behinderung, Queer, Minderheiten in der Technik), die sich regelmäßig mit dem People-Team treffen. Während Ihrer Interviews und darüber hinaus bitten und ermutigen wir jeden, der eine Anpassung benötigt, diese von seinem Recruiter anzufordern.

Wir danken Ihnen für die Bereitstellung dieser Daten, wenn Sie sich dafür entscheiden.

Senior Backend Engineer (Elixir) Arbeitgeber: Global HR Solutions & Employment Tools for Distributed Teams

Remote ist ein hervorragender Arbeitgeber, der eine innovative und unterstützende Arbeitskultur fördert, in der Mitarbeiter aus der ganzen Welt zusammenarbeiten können. Mit flexiblen Arbeitszeiten, der Möglichkeit, von überall zu arbeiten, und einem starken Fokus auf persönliche und berufliche Entwicklung bietet Remote seinen Mitarbeitern bedeutende Herausforderungen und die Chance, einen echten Einfluss auf das Unternehmen zu haben. Darüber hinaus sorgt das Unternehmen für faire Vergütung und umfassende Benefits, die das Wohlbefinden der Mitarbeiter unterstützen.
G

Kontaktperson:

Global HR Solutions & Employment Tools for Distributed Teams HR Team

StudySmarter Bewerbungstipps 🤫

So bekommst du den Job: Senior Backend Engineer (Elixir)

Tipp Nummer 1

Sei proaktiv! Wenn du dich für die Stelle als Senior Backend Engineer interessierst, zögere nicht, direkt mit uns in Kontakt zu treten. Zeige dein Interesse und stelle Fragen über die Rolle oder das Team, um einen bleibenden Eindruck zu hinterlassen.

Tipp Nummer 2

Nutze dein Netzwerk! Sprich mit Leuten, die bereits bei Remote arbeiten oder in der Branche tätig sind. Empfehlungen können dir helfen, die Aufmerksamkeit der Recruiter auf dich zu lenken und deine Chancen zu erhöhen.

Tipp Nummer 3

Bereite dich gut auf die Interviews vor! Informiere dich über unsere Produkte und Technologien, insbesondere über Elixir und CI/CD-Tools. Zeige, dass du nicht nur die technischen Fähigkeiten hast, sondern auch ein echtes Interesse an unserer Mission und Kultur.

Tipp Nummer 4

Bewirb dich direkt über unsere Website! Das macht es für uns einfacher, deine Bewerbung zu verfolgen und sicherzustellen, dass du die bestmögliche Chance bekommst, Teil unseres Teams zu werden. Lass uns gemeinsam die Zukunft der Arbeit gestalten!

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Senior Backend Engineer (Elixir)

Elixir
Phoenix
Postgres
CI/CD
GitLab
Kubernetes
Docker
AWS
API-Design
Systemdenken
Automatisierungs-Workflows
Code-Reviews
Mentoring
Debugging
Agilität

Tipps für deine Bewerbung 🫡

Sei authentisch!: Zeig uns, wer du wirklich bist! Deine Persönlichkeit und Erfahrungen sind wichtig, also lass sie in deiner Bewerbung durchscheinen. Wir suchen nach Menschen, die neugierig und motiviert sind.

Mach es klar und präzise!: Halte deine Bewerbung übersichtlich und auf den Punkt. Verwende klare Sprache und strukturiere deine Informationen so, dass wir schnell einen Überblick über deine Fähigkeiten und Erfahrungen bekommen.

Betone deine technischen Skills!: Da wir mit Elixir, Postgres und CI/CD-Tools arbeiten, solltest du deine relevanten technischen Fähigkeiten hervorheben. Zeig uns, wie du diese Technologien in der Vergangenheit genutzt hast, um Probleme zu lösen.

Bewirb dich über unsere Website!: Wir empfehlen dir, deine Bewerbung direkt über unsere Website einzureichen. So stellst du sicher, dass alles reibungslos läuft und wir deine Unterlagen schnell bearbeiten können.

Wie du dich auf ein Vorstellungsgespräch bei Global HR Solutions & Employment Tools for Distributed Teams vorbereitest

Verstehe die Technologie

Mach dich mit Elixir, Phoenix und Postgres vertraut. Sei bereit, über deine Erfahrungen mit diesen Technologien zu sprechen und wie du sie in früheren Projekten eingesetzt hast. Zeige, dass du die Prinzipien hinter diesen Tools verstehst und wie sie zur Lösung komplexer Probleme beitragen können.

Bereite dich auf Systemdenken vor

Da das Unternehmen Wert auf systematisches Denken legt, solltest du Beispiele parat haben, wie du Spezifikationen klar definiert und Pläne in umsetzbare Schritte zerlegt hast. Überlege dir, wie du Qualität sicherstellen und Feedbackschleifen implementieren kannst, um die Ergebnisse zu überprüfen.

Zeige deine Innovationskraft

Remote sucht nach kreativen Lösungen und innovativen Ansätzen. Bereite einige Ideen vor, wie du agentische Workflows oder Automatisierung in deinen bisherigen Projekten implementiert hast. Diskutiere, wie du bestehende Prozesse verbessert hast und welche neuen Ansätze du vorschlagen würdest.

Sei bereit für technische Herausforderungen

Erwarte technische Fragen oder Aufgaben während des Interviews. Übe Coding-Challenges im Vorfeld und sei bereit, deinen Denkprozess zu erklären. Zeige, dass du nicht nur die Lösung kennst, sondern auch verstehst, warum sie funktioniert und welche Alternativen es gibt.

Schneller zum Traumjob mit Premium

Deine Bewerbung wird als „Top Bewerbung“ bei unseren Partnern gekennzeichnet
Individuelles Feedback zu Lebenslauf und Anschreiben, einschließlich der Anpassung an spezifische Stellenanforderungen
Gehöre zu den ersten Bewerbern für neue Stellen mit unserem AI Bewerbungsassistenten
1:1 Unterstützung und Karriereberatung durch unsere Career Coaches
Premium gehen

Geld-zurück-Garantie, wenn du innerhalb von 6 Monaten keinen Job findest

>